Output 958207db4094deedb83cdd7bed8c6543d7614b54e8a7b269d3ad5fbfe2f23562:1

value
127856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c90af66e0a567f1b49289b8e4e805b263362574 OP_EQUAL
address
3MoFueXcYbXgwdrSCTzrZWs1yCgrUaRSfS
transaction
958207db4094deedb83cdd7bed8c6543d7614b54e8a7b269d3ad5fbfe2f23562
spent
true